August 23 - The International Paralympic Committee (IPC) is pleased to announce the appointment of Craig Spence as the new IPC Media & Communications Senior Manager.
Spence previously worked as communications manager for the Rugby Football League (RFL) until May. Within the IPC he will be responsible for the creation and implementation of a comprehensive communications strategy as well as actting as the official spokesperson for the organisation.
Spence will take up the full-time position from September 1 at the IPC's headquarters in Bonn.
IPC President Sir Philip Craven said: "We are delighted that someone of Craig's quality is now joining us and we look forward to him joining up with the IPC."
Educated at the University of Central Lancashire, Spence also has experience of working as account manager at public relations agency Ptarmigan and PR executive at major UK-based water company Yorkshire Water.
